Sunshine Coast partners with Expedia to encourage interstate tourism
With borders now reopened, Visit Sunshine Coast has launched a new campaign with leading travel platform Expedia Group under the Wotif booking site to encourage travellers to return to the region.
The new campaign aligns with Sunshine Coast’s ‘Immerse Yourself For real’ campaign which highlights inspirational reasons to visit the region.
Targeting the key interstate markets of New South Wales and Victoria as well as intrastate Queensland, the new campaign offers special deals of up to 15% off accommodation.
Visit Sunshine Coast Chief Executive Matt Stoeckel said the aim of the online campaign was simple - to increase visitors, room nights and travel to the region during the destination shoulder periods.
Stoeckel advised “with over 150 Sunshine Coast accommodation offerings listed via Wotif, this exciting campaign will provide hot deals for holiday-makers to book their next break on the Sunshine Coast,
“We know there is pent up demand for travel to the Sunshine Coast, particularly from the key states of New South Wales and Victoria. Interstate travel is back in 2022 and we look forward to welcoming these high-value visitors that spend more and stay longer.”
Wotif Managing Director Daniel Finch adds “Wotif is thrilled to be able to help encourage even more Aussies to visit the beautiful Sunshine Coast. We know it’s a favourite spot for Aussie travellers year-round, and with borders open and excellent deals on offer, it’s the perfect time to lock in your next getaway.”
The Wotif campaign is running from now until 5th March.
